在当今数字经济时代,在线商城已经成为了许多企业的重要组成部分。随着开源技术的迅速发展,越来越多的开发者和创业者开始在GitHub上寻找适合的商城模板。本文将深入探讨商城模板在GitHub上的资源,包括如何寻找、使用和定制商城模板,以满足不同的业务需求。
什么是商城模板?
商城模板是指用于构建在线商店的预设设计和功能模块。这些模板通常包含前端和后端代码,帮助开发者快速构建和启动电子商务平台。常见的商城模板包括:
- React商城模板
- Vue商城模板
- HTML/CSS商城模板
- WordPress商城模板
通过使用开源的商城模板,企业可以节省开发时间和成本,快速进入市场。
GitHub上的商城模板资源
在GitHub上,有许多开源的商城模板项目。这些项目通常具有以下特征:
- 代码开源:允许开发者自由使用、修改和分发代码。
- 活跃的社区:通常有积极的开发者社区,提供支持和更新。
- 文档完整:大部分项目都有详细的使用说明和文档,方便新手上手。
如何搜索商城模板?
在GitHub上搜索商城模板时,可以使用以下关键词:
E-commerce template
Online store template
Shop template
使用这些关键词可以帮助你快速找到合适的项目。
常见的商城模板项目
以下是一些受欢迎的商城模板项目:
-
Shopify Lite
- 适用于小型商店的简易模板。
- 支持多种支付方式。
- 社区支持良好。
-
Vue Storefront
- 适合使用Vue.js构建的现代化商城。
- 具有高性能和可扩展性。
- 支持PWA功能。
-
React Storefront
- 现代化的电商解决方案,使用React框架。
- 自带响应式设计,适合各种设备。
- 强大的状态管理和路由功能。
如何使用GitHub上的商城模板?
使用GitHub上的商城模板主要分为以下几个步骤:
1. 克隆仓库
使用git clone
命令将项目克隆到本地: bash git clone https://github.com/username/repo.git
2. 安装依赖
进入项目目录后,根据项目文档安装依赖: bash cd repo npm install
3. 运行项目
通过以下命令启动项目: bash npm run start
4. 自定义模板
根据业务需求,自定义模板的样式和功能。可以修改前端页面、API接口等。
商城模板的定制与优化
商城模板虽然可以快速启动,但为了满足特定业务需求,通常需要进行定制和优化。以下是一些定制建议:
- 界面设计:根据品牌形象设计商城的用户界面。
- 功能扩展:添加更多的支付方式、物流接口等功能。
- 性能优化:使用CDN加速,优化资源加载速度。
常见问题解答(FAQ)
1. GitHub上的商城模板可以商业使用吗?
绝大多数GitHub上的商城模板都是开源的,可以用于商业项目,但需遵循相应的开源协议(如MIT、GPL等)。在使用前,建议查看项目的许可证。
2. 如何选择合适的商城模板?
选择商城模板时,可考虑以下因素:
- 业务需求:模板是否满足你的特定业务功能。
- 技术栈:确保模板与现有技术栈兼容。
- 社区活跃度:选择维护活跃、更新频繁的项目。
3. 如果在使用模板时遇到问题,应该怎么办?
遇到问题时,可以参考以下几种方式解决:
- 查阅文档:首先查看项目的文档,获取使用说明。
- 提问社区:在项目的GitHub页面或相关论坛提问。
- 查看问题列表:检查项目的issue页面,看看是否有人遇到相同问题并已解决。
4. 有没有推荐的学习资源?
- YouTube视频:许多开发者会分享使用商城模板的教程。
- 在线课程:平台如Udemy、Coursera上有许多关于电商开发的课程。
- 博客文章:许多技术博客会分享关于商城模板的使用经验和最佳实践。
结论
商城模板在GitHub上为开发者和创业者提供了丰富的资源。通过有效地使用和定制这些模板,企业能够快速构建高效的在线商店。希望本文能为你在寻找和使用商城模板的过程中提供帮助。